Side-by-Side Cost Comparison

Care TypePort St. Lucie, FLStamford, CTNational Avg
Nursing Home (Private)$11,928/mo$13,914/mo$9,514/mo
Assisted Living$5,250/mo$5,718/mo$4,612/mo
Home Health Aide$31.13/hr$27.84/hr$25.82/hr
Adult Day Care$2,075/mo$2,188/mo$1,692/mo

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Port St. Lucie or Stamford cheaper for senior care?
Port St. Lucie, FL is cheaper for nursing home care at $11,928/mo vs $13,914/mo in Stamford, CT — a difference of $1,986/mo.
What does assisted living cost in Port St. Lucie vs Stamford?
Assisted living in Port St. Lucie, FL costs $5,250/mo. In Stamford, CT it costs $5,718/mo. The national average is $4,612/mo.
What is the home health aide rate in Port St. Lucie vs Stamford?
Home health aides in Port St. Lucie, FL charge $31.13/hr. In Stamford, CT the rate is $27.84/hr.
How do Port St. Lucie senior care costs compare to the national average?
The national average nursing home cost is $9,514/mo. Port St. Lucie, FL at $11,928/mo is above average. Stamford, CT at $13,914/mo is above average.
